-
21 Technology Dr
East Setauket, NY 11733
631-751-3583
-
21 Technology Dr
East Setauket, NY 11733
631-751-3583
-
23 Technology Dr
East Setauket, NY 11733
631-246-6461
-
23 Technology Dr
East Setauket, NY 11733
631-689-7300
-
23 Technology Dr
East Setauket, NY 11733
631-689-7300
-
23 Technology Dr
East Setauket, NY 11733
631-689-7300
-
3400 Technology Dr Ste
East Setauket, NY 11733
631-751-2020
-
3400 Technology Dr Ste
East Setauket, NY 11733
631-335-9373
-
3400 Technology Dr Ste
East Setauket, NY 11733
631-335-9373
-
3400 Technology Dr Ste
East Setauket, NY 11733
631-335-9373